The UAE Employment Visa is a mandatory requirement for foreign nationals who have secured a job in the country. Issued by the employer and approved by the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ation (MOHRE), this visa allows legal work and residence in the UAE for up to 2 years, renewable. Service Types:
New
Apply for a fresh employment visa after receiving a valid job offer and approval from the Ministry of Labor. We ensure smooth onboarding and immigration clearance.
Renew
Renew your existing employment visa before it expires. Typically done every 1 or 2 years depending on contract terms and emirate regulations.
Cancel
Process visa cancellation upon resignation, job change, or exit from the UAE. Necessary to avoid overstay fines and maintain immigration records.
Transfer
Transfer sponsorship to a new employer within the UAE without leaving the country. Subject to MOHRE approval and contract termination from previous employer.
Available Employment Visa Services
- Private Sector Visa (Mainland) Issued for employees working with UAE mainland companies. Involves labor contract approval from MOHRE and residency processing.
- Free Zone Employment Visa Specific to employees in UAE Free Zones. Sponsored by the Free Zone Authority, often with easier transfer and processing policies.
- Government Sector Employment Visa Provided by UAE government or semi-government entities. Typically includes 2–3 year validity and premium processing.
- Domestic Worker Visa For roles such as drivers, maids, cooks, and nannies. Requires medical tests, police clearance, and employer sponsorship.
Documents Required for Employment Visa
- Passport Copy: Color copy of the employee’s passport, valid for at least 6 months at the time of application.
- Passport-Sized Photograph: Recent photo with white background meeting UAE visa standards.
- Educational Certificates (if required): Attested degree or diploma certificates depending on job role. Must be attested by home country authorities and UAE MOFA.
- Offer Letter & Employment Contract: Official job offer and signed labor contract from the hiring company approved by MOHRE or Free Zone Authority.
- Medical Fitness Certificate: Issued by a UAE-authorized clinic or hospital confirming the applicant is fit for employment and free from infectious diseases.
- Emirates ID Biometrics Appointment: Applicants must attend a biometric scan at an official Emirates ID center after medical clearance.
- Entry Permit (if outside UAE): A temporary visa issued to enter the UAE for residency stamping, valid for 60 days.
Employment Visa Processing Time & Fees
- Processing Time: Typical processing takes 5 to 10 working days after document submission. May vary by employer type and location.
- Medical & Emirates ID Fees: Medical test costs range from AED 300–500; Emirates ID fees are approx. AED 170/year depending on duration.
- Visa Stamping Fees: Final residency stamping on the passport costs approx. AED 500–1,000 depending on emirate and validity period.
- Renewal & Cancellation Fees: Renewal charges are similar to new visa processing. Cancellation fees vary but typically range AED 150–300.
